Entrance to Storga Park – Riverside Path along the Sile loop from Paese

04:00

65.8km

130m

Cycling

Moderate bike ride. Good fitness required. Mostly paved surfaces. Suitable for all skill levels.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.

Entrance to Storga Park

Highlight • Rest Area

The Storga Park was created through a recovery and environmental arrangement of the former Azienda Agricola Provincia Sant'Artemio, formerly the Ergotherapy Colony of the Psychiatric Hospital of Sant'Artemio.
